Overview

Request 5395 (accepted)

- Update to version 3.5
New features:
* Real-time VBV for ABR (Average BitRate) encodes in –pass 2
using --vbv-live-multi-pass. Improves VBV compliance with no
significant impact on coding efficiency.
Enhancements to existing features:
* Improved hist-based scene cut algorithm: Reduces false
positives by leveraging motion and scene transition info.
* Support for RADL pictures at IDR scene cuts: Improves coding
efficiency with no significant impact on performance.
* Bidirectional scene cut aware Frame Quantizer Selection:
Saves bits than forward masking with no noticeable perceptual
quality difference.
API changes:
* Additions to x265_param structure to support the newly added
features and encoder enhancements.
* New x265_param options --min-vbv-fullness and
--max-vbv-fullness to control min and max VBV fullness.
Bug fixes:
* Incorrect VBV lookahead in --analysis-load + --scale-factor.
* Encoder hang when VBV is used with slices.
* QP spikes in the row-level VBV rate-control when WPP enabled.
* Encoder crash in --abr-ladder.
- Use new homepage and download URLs.
- Add subpackage for HDR10+ library
- Add update.sh

Submit package Staging / x265 to package Essentials / x265

x265.changes Changed
x265.spec Changed
baselibs.conf Changed
update.sh Added
x265_3.4.tar.gz/.hg_archival.txt Deleted
x265_3.4.tar.gz/source/cmake/version.cmake Deleted
x265_3.5.tar.gz/. Added
x265_3.5.tar.gz/build Added
x265_3.5.tar.gz/build/aarch64-linux Added
x265_3.5.tar.gz/build/arm-linux Added
x265_3.5.tar.gz/build/linux Added
x265_3.5.tar.gz/build/msys Added
x265_3.5.tar.gz/build/msys-cl Added
x265_3.5.tar.gz/build/vc10-x86 Added
x265_3.5.tar.gz/build/vc10-x86_64 Added
x265_3.5.tar.gz/build/vc11-x86 Added
x265_3.5.tar.gz/build/vc11-x86_64 Added
x265_3.5.tar.gz/build/vc12-x86 Added
x265_3.5.tar.gz/build/vc12-x86_64 Added
x265_3.5.tar.gz/build/vc15-x86 Added
x265_3.5.tar.gz/build/vc15-x86_64 Added
x265_3.5.tar.gz/build/vc9-x86 Added
x265_3.5.tar.gz/build/vc9-x86_64 Added
x265_3.5.tar.gz/build/xcode Added
x265_3.5.tar.gz/doc Added
x265_3.5.tar.gz/doc/intra Added
x265_3.5.tar.gz/doc/reST Added
x265_3.4.tar.gz/doc/reST/cli.rst -> x265_3.5.tar.gz/doc/reST/cli.rst Changed
x265_3.4.tar.gz/doc/reST/introduction.rst -> x265_3.5.tar.gz/doc/reST/introduction.rst Changed
x265_3.4.tar.gz/doc/reST/releasenotes.rst -> x265_3.5.tar.gz/doc/reST/releasenotes.rst Changed
x265_3.5.tar.gz/doc/uncrustify Added
x265_3.5.tar.gz/source Added
x265_3.4.tar.gz/source/CMakeLists.txt -> x265_3.5.tar.gz/source/CMakeLists.txt Changed
x265_3.4.tar.gz/source/abrEncApp.cpp -> x265_3.5.tar.gz/source/abrEncApp.cpp Changed
x265_3.5.tar.gz/source/cmake Added
x265_3.5.tar.gz/source/cmake/Version.cmake Added
x265_3.5.tar.gz/source/common Added
x265_3.5.tar.gz/source/common/aarch64 Added
x265_3.5.tar.gz/source/common/arm Added
x265_3.4.tar.gz/source/common/frame.cpp -> x265_3.5.tar.gz/source/common/frame.cpp Changed
x265_3.4.tar.gz/source/common/frame.h -> x265_3.5.tar.gz/source/common/frame.h Changed
x265_3.4.tar.gz/source/common/lowres.cpp -> x265_3.5.tar.gz/source/common/lowres.cpp Changed
x265_3.4.tar.gz/source/common/lowres.h -> x265_3.5.tar.gz/source/common/lowres.h Changed
x265_3.4.tar.gz/source/common/param.cpp -> x265_3.5.tar.gz/source/common/param.cpp Changed
x265_3.5.tar.gz/source/common/ppc Added
x265_3.5.tar.gz/source/common/vec Added
x265_3.5.tar.gz/source/common/x86 Added
x265_3.5.tar.gz/source/compat Added
x265_3.5.tar.gz/source/compat/getopt Added
x265_3.5.tar.gz/source/compat/msvc Added
x265_3.5.tar.gz/source/dynamicHDR10 Added
x265_3.5.tar.gz/source/dynamicHDR10/json11 Added
x265_3.5.tar.gz/source/encoder Added
x265_3.4.tar.gz/source/encoder/api.cpp -> x265_3.5.tar.gz/source/encoder/api.cpp Changed
x265_3.4.tar.gz/source/encoder/encoder.cpp -> x265_3.5.tar.gz/source/encoder/encoder.cpp Changed
x265_3.4.tar.gz/source/encoder/encoder.h -> x265_3.5.tar.gz/source/encoder/encoder.h Changed
x265_3.4.tar.gz/source/encoder/frameencoder.cpp -> x265_3.5.tar.gz/source/encoder/frameencoder.cpp Changed
x265_3.4.tar.gz/source/encoder/frameencoder.h -> x265_3.5.tar.gz/source/encoder/frameencoder.h Changed
x265_3.4.tar.gz/source/encoder/ratecontrol.cpp -> x265_3.5.tar.gz/source/encoder/ratecontrol.cpp Changed
x265_3.4.tar.gz/source/encoder/ratecontrol.h -> x265_3.5.tar.gz/source/encoder/ratecontrol.h Changed
x265_3.4.tar.gz/source/encoder/slicetype.cpp -> x265_3.5.tar.gz/source/encoder/slicetype.cpp Changed
x265_3.4.tar.gz/source/encoder/slicetype.h -> x265_3.5.tar.gz/source/encoder/slicetype.h Changed
x265_3.5.tar.gz/source/input Added
x265_3.5.tar.gz/source/output Added
x265_3.5.tar.gz/source/profile Added
x265_3.5.tar.gz/source/profile/PPA Added
x265_3.5.tar.gz/source/profile/vtune Added
x265_3.5.tar.gz/source/test Added
x265_3.4.tar.gz/source/test/rate-control-tests.txt -> x265_3.5.tar.gz/source/test/rate-control-tests.txt Changed
x265_3.4.tar.gz/source/test/regression-tests.txt -> x265_3.5.tar.gz/source/test/regression-tests.txt Changed
x265_3.4.tar.gz/source/x265.cpp -> x265_3.5.tar.gz/source/x265.cpp Changed
x265_3.4.tar.gz/source/x265.h -> x265_3.5.tar.gz/source/x265.h Changed
x265_3.4.tar.gz/source/x265cli.cpp -> x265_3.5.tar.gz/source/x265cli.cpp Changed
x265_3.4.tar.gz/source/x265cli.h -> x265_3.5.tar.gz/source/x265cli.h Changed
x265_3.5.tar.gz/x265Version.txt Added
Refresh
Refresh
Request History
Olaf Hering's avatar

olh created request almost 3 years ago

- Update to version 3.5
New features:
* Real-time VBV for ABR (Average BitRate) encodes in –pass 2
using --vbv-live-multi-pass. Improves VBV compliance with no
significant impact on coding efficiency.
Enhancements to existing features:
* Improved hist-based scene cut algorithm: Reduces false
positives by leveraging motion and scene transition info.
* Support for RADL pictures at IDR scene cuts: Improves coding
efficiency with no significant impact on performance.
* Bidirectional scene cut aware Frame Quantizer Selection:
Saves bits than forward masking with no noticeable perceptual
quality difference.
API changes:
* Additions to x265_param structure to support the newly added
features and encoder enhancements.
* New x265_param options --min-vbv-fullness and
--max-vbv-fullness to control min and max VBV fullness.
Bug fixes:
* Incorrect VBV lookahead in --analysis-load + --scale-factor.
* Encoder hang when VBV is used with slices.
* QP spikes in the row-level VBV rate-control when WPP enabled.
* Encoder crash in --abr-ladder.
- Use new homepage and download URLs.
- Add subpackage for HDR10+ library
- Add update.sh


Olaf Hering's avatar

olh accepted request almost 3 years ago